Films including Gone With The Wind, Flash Gordon and the animated version of Dumbo that are available on Sky Cinema now come with a warning that they contain “outdated attitudes, language and cultural depictions which may cause offence today”.
The channel, which is also available on Now TV, has added a disclaimer to a number of titles to warn viewers about issues of cultural sensitivities and potentially offensive attitudes.
It comes after streaming service HBO Max removed Gone With The Wind following criticism of its “racist depictions”. The 1939 epic, set in the south of the US during the American Civil War, will return to the service with a discussion about its historical context and criticism of its “racial prejudices”.
